Biography
Becoming a forensic trial consultant was not a chosen career — it was a matter of survival. More than forty years ago, Dean Tong faced false accusations that nearly cost him his children. He fought back, won his case, and then spent the next three decades helping others do the same.
Mr. Tong’s work has been recognized in Wikipedia and Everipedia and was selected as a 2018 Marquis Who’s Who Albert Nelson Lifetime Achievement Award recipient. He has appeared on the Dr. Phil show and CBS 48 Hours, and commented in outlets including Family Lawyer Magazine, Divorce Magazine, The Epoch Times, and The National Enquirer.
His abuse-excuse archive has served parents, attorneys, and courts online for nearly three decades. He has assisted in cases from all fifty states and now offers remote testimony by Zoom and phone to reduce the cost of justice for indigent litigants.

Philosophy
“We will not win the war against child abuse until we first win the battle against false accusations of child abuse.”
Approximately two-thirds of all child abuse reports turn out to be unfounded. This is not a denial of real abuse — it is a defense of real justice. The same professionals who are entrusted to protect children can, through confirmatory bias and source misattribution, entangle the innocent.
Mr. Tong's work articulates scientific facts to child protection investigators, teachers, attorneys, and judges — urging caution in the rush to judge. Real abusers deserve full prosecution. The wrongly accused deserve a vigorous, informed defense.
